Frequently Asked Questions

Approximately 9.2% of the population in Salt Lake County, Utah does not have health insurance coverage.

In Salt Lake County, Utah, young adult males (18-34) face the highest barrier to coverage, with an uninsured rate of 15.7%. This is notably higher than the overall local average of 9.2%.
